Michel Chevalier was a French engineer, economist, and writer known for his insightful observations on American society and politics during the 19th century. His notable work, "Society, Manners and Politics in the United States," is a series of letters that provide a detailed account of his experiences and reflections while traveling in North America. Chevalier's writings not only capture the cultural and social dynamics of the United States but also contribute to the understanding of the historical context of his time. Additionally, he explored significant engineering projects, as seen in his work "L'isthme de Panama," where he examined the potential for a canal through Panama, reflecting his interests in geography and infrastructure.
